Work Clothing Committee Sample Clauses

Work Clothing Committee. The Region and the Union shall maintain an ad hoc Work Clothing Committee composed of up to three (3) members of each party. The Committee shall be responsible for making recommendations to the Region and the Union, with a copy to the Union, on any changes in the items of clothing items on the list and issues of quality. The Committee will meet each year no later than February 28 to review the work clothing issues. The committee will report their recommendations to the Region, with a copy to the Union, by the first week in June. Any amendments to the Work Clothing Order Form (Appendix “B”) will be in accordance with article 22.02 d) of the Collective Agreement.

Work Clothing Committee. The Corporation and the Union shall maintain an ad hoc Work Clothing Committee composed of up to three (3) members of each party. The Committee Shall be responsible for, but not limited to:  Items of clothing on the clothing list  Issues of quality  Review the current clothing service and products The Committee will meet each year no later than June 1st to review the work clothing issues. The committee will report their recommendations to the Corporation, with a copy to the Union, by September 1st.   • Steering Committee The Project Manager shall set up a Steering Committee for the Project, consisting of representatives from the Department, the Contractor, and any other key organisations whom the project will impact on, to be agreed between the parties. The function of the Steering Committee shall be to review the scope and direction of the Project against its aims and objectives, monitor progress and efficiency, and assess, manage and review expected impact and use of the findings from the Project. The Committee shall meet at times and dates agreed by the parties, or in the absence of agreement, specified by the Department. The Contractor’s representatives on the Steering Committee shall report their views on the progress of the Project to the Steering Committee in writing if requested by the Department. The Contractor’s representatives on the Steering Committee shall attend all meetings of the Steering Committee unless otherwise agreed by the Department.
